In Q4 2022, the top 5 Maps and Navigation apps on the Android platform in Australia exhibited diverse trends in downloads, revenue, and active user numbers. Here's a closer look at their performance based on data from Sensor Tower:
Spacetalk from Spacetalk Ltd. saw a fluctuation in weekly revenue, with a notable peak of approximately $11.4K in the final week of December. Weekly downloads showed significant growth towards the end of the quarter, reaching 2.2K in the week of December 19.
Navionics® Boating by Garmin Italy Technologies srl experienced an increase in weekly revenue, peaking at around $7.5K in the last week of December. Weekly downloads remained relatively steady, averaging around 700, while active users increased from 1.2K to 1.6K throughout the quarter.
Circuit Route Planner from Circuit Routing Limited maintained a stable weekly revenue, ending the quarter with approximately $4.1K. Downloads fluctuated, peaking at 586 in the week of December 12, while active users saw a slight decline from 1.8K to 1.7K.
Australian Geology Travel Maps by Trilobite Solutions showed a consistent decline in weekly revenue, dropping to around $639 by the end of December. Downloads followed a similar trend, decreasing from 112 in late September to 40 in the last week of December.
Hema 4WD Maps Australia from Hema Maps Pty Ltd had a fluctuating revenue pattern, with a peak of approximately $1.7K in the final week of December. Weekly downloads remained low, averaging around 40, with a slight increase to 64 in the week of December 19.
